For Masai Russell, preparing for a track meet is about more than just being at her best when she crosses the finish line. “I feel like I’m stepping into my alter ego when I put on makeup,” the 24-year-old sprinter and hurdler tells SELF. “I feel like beauty and the beast.”

Russell took us along as she prepared for Athlos, the first major all-female track and field competition which took place last weekend in New York. Thirty-six elite runners, including Gabby Thomas, Brittany Brown and Nia Atkins, competed alongside Russell in the inaugural Athlos competition, which concluded with a performance by Megan Thee Stallion and boasted for the highest prize for a women’s athletics event. Even though she just won her first (gold!) Olympic medal, the honor of competing at this particular event was not lost on Russell, who took third place in the 100m hurdles: “I’m so excited to be part of an exclusively female competition. “, she tells SELF. “It just means the world is a part of (Athlos) and one of the best women to compete in this event. And I can still say that I was at the first!

Russell doesn’t play around when it comes to prep, on the runway, or in her makeup routine. She starts with a Caudalie moisturizer and serum, to give her other products a smooth, long-lasting base. Foundations aren’t really her thing; instead, she sticks to a more targeted concealer application. She uses the ultra-pigmented Armani Beauty Luminous Silk Cheek Tint when competing and defines her cheekbones with MAC Skinfinish Sunstruck Matte Bronzer. And for that final shimmer (which hits just mid-sprint), she gets by with a little help from Rihanna and Serena Williams: Fenty highlighter and Wyn lip serum.

“People ask me all the time, ‘How do your eyelashes stay in place when you run?’ » Russell said. Her secret: Duo Lash Glue, and a very meticulous application method (worth the effort in itself). And for a setting spray — a product we should exclusively get from professional athletes, TBH — she favors a combination of MAC Fix+ and One/Size.

A flawless makeup routine isn’t Russell’s only pregame ritual — she also planned to watch a few motivational speeches over a Chipotle bowl before lacing up her tips — but for Athlos in particular, it’s was the perfect way to get into the zone. At its core, the competition is about allowing female athletes to shine and showcasing the bold, beautiful and diverse experiences of women in elite competition.
